  • i have the same problem as jo3n4rd. you said at the beggining of this video that there will be 2 corners where they need to be. you said that its impossible for you not to have at least 2 corners unless you remove the stickers, but i have never once taken off a sticker. help?

  • IF THE TOP TWO LAYERS ARE SOLVED you can ALWAYS get either 2 or all 4 corners into the right PLACE by just turning the bottom layer, ALWAYS. They won't neccessarily be the right ORIENTATION (right colors on right side) but they should be in the right PLACE. Once you get all 4 in the right PLACE, then you orient them. Does that help?
